body{
	font-family: Arial,sans-serif;
	font-size: 14px;
}
h1,h2,h3,h4,h5,h6 {
	font-family: Arial,sans-serif;
} 
.main-navigation ul li a{
  font-family: Arial,sans-serif; 
	
} 
.cm-header-one .top-header{
	background-color: #697206;
}
.top-header{
	background-color: #697206;
	
}
.cm-header-one .top-header-left ul li:last-child {
	margin-right: -285px;
    float: right;
    margin-top: 3px;
}
.menu-item-27028 img{
	max-width: 15px;
}
.cm-header-one .top-header-left ul li a{
    z-index: 999;
    position: relative;  
    font-size: 14px;
	font-family: Arial,sans-serif;
	color: white;
}
ul.social-icons li a[href*="facebook.com"]::before {
	color: skyblue;
}
.social-share ul.social-icons{
	display: none;
}
.news_ticker_wrap .ticker_head {
	background-color: #fbc729;
}
.general-header{
	background-color: #dae900;
}
#main-nav{
	background-color: #697202;
}
div.footer_inner{
	background-color: #697206;
}
.cm-col-lg-5{
	    flex: 0 0 56.666667%;
    max-width: 56.666667%;
} 
#custom_html-14.widget_text.widget.widget_custom_html{
	max-width: 400px;
}

.custom-logo{
	max-width: 70%;
}
.the_title{
	display: none;
}
h2{
	font-size: 30px;
}
h3{
	font-size: 24px;
}
h3.wp-block-heading{
	font-weight: 700;
}
h4{
	font-size: 21px;
}
h4.wp-block-heading{
	font-weight: 600;
}
h5{
	font-size: 18px;
}
h6{
	font-size: 16px;
}
ul, ol{
	margin-left: 30px
}
li{
	list-style:outside;
}
hr {
	background-color: #697206;
	height: 1px;
}
.the_content h2{
	font-weight: bold;
}
.the_content .wp-block-latest-posts{
	background: none;
	padding-top: 0;
}
.the_content .wp-block-latest-posts li{
	color: #000;
}
.the_content .wp-block-categories .cat-item a, .the_content .wp-block-latest-posts li a, .the_content .wp-block-archives li a{
	color: #697202;
}
.the_content .wp-block-latest-posts li a:hover{
	color: #697206;
}
.breadcrumb ul li span{
	color: #697206;
	text-transform: none;
	font-size: 14px;
}
.breadcrumb ul li:last-child span {
	color: #aaaf3b;
}
.lesetipp{
	height:150px;
}
#post-616 .post_thumb{
	margin-bottom: -10px;
}
.copyrights{
	display: none;
}
div.col-md-7.col-sm-6.col-xs-12{
	display: none;
}
div.col-md-5.col-sm-6.col-xs-12{
	width: 62%;
}
.footer_nav ul li {
	float: left;
}
.footer-widget-container .widget:last-child{
	text-align: center;
}
.the_content h2{
	color: #697206;
}
article .the_content a{
	color: #697206;
}
#co2{
	background: #697206;
	padding:10px;
	margin-bottom: 20px;
	width: 100%;
}
#co2 h2{
	font-size: 18px;
	background: #dae900;
	text-align: center;
	color: #697206;	
}
#co2 h6{
	font-size: 14px;
	font-weight: normal;
	color: #fff;
	margin-bottom: 0;
}
#co2 p{
	color: #fff;
	margin: 0px 0 0 140px;
	font-size: 12px;
}
#co2 span{
	color: #fff;
	font-size: 12px;
}
#co2 a{
	color: #fff;
	font-size: 12px;
}
#co2-inner{
	display: block;
	margin-left: auto;
	margin-right: auto;
	width:270px;
    background: transparent;
}
ul.post-categories li a{
	background-color: #dae900;
}
.rltdpstsplgn-latest-posts article{
	height: 100%;
	
}
.rltdpstsplgn-latest-posts h3{
	font-size: 24px;
	margin-bottom: 0;
}
.rltdpstsplgn-latest-posts p{
	min-height: 100px;
}
.rltdpstsplgn-latest-posts h3 a{
	color: #697206;
}
.rltdpstsplgn_date entry-date{
	font-size: 12px;
}
.middle-news-area .widget img{
	margin-right: 15px;
}
a.more-link{
 margin-left: 5px;
	text-decoration: underline !important;
}
.wppsac-post-slider.design-1 .wppsac-post-image-bg{
	min-height: 500px;
}
.social{
	display: block;
	width: 40%;
	float:right;
	position:relative;
	margin-bottom: 15px;
}
#text-8{
	margin-bottom: 5px;	
}
h4.pt-cv-title a{
	color: #697206;
}
#text-10{
	border: 1px solid red;
}
.item a{
	color: #fc2860;
}
.textwidget a{
	color: #697206;
}
#custom_html-6{
	padding:0px;
}
#c8471 hr{
	background-color: #ddd;
	margin: 10px 0;
	height: 2px;
}
.section-title h2::after{
	background-color: #697206;
}
a.more-link{
	color: #697206;
}
a:hover.more-link{
	background-color: #dae900;
}
.the_content p a{
	color: #697206;
	font-weight: 700;
	text-decoration: none;
}
.the_content p a:hover{
	background-color: #dae900;
}
.widget-title h2::after{
	display: none;
}
.widget-title h2{
	text-align: center;
}
.gosign-simple-teaser-block{
	display: inline-block;
	width: 100%;
	border-top: 1px solid #697206;
	border-bottom: 1px solid #697206;
		margin:10px 0 20px 0;
}
.gosign-simple-teaser-block h1{
	margin-top: 0px;
}
.gosign-simple-teaser-block p{
	margin-top: 10px;
}
.gosign-simple-teaser-block figure{
	margin-bottom: 0;
}
.gosign-simple-teaser-block h2{
	font-size: 20px;
  color: #697206;
	margin: 35px 0 0;
}
.gosign-simple-teaser-block a{
  color: #697206;
}
.gosign-simple-teaser-block img{
   padding:15px;
	
}
.gosign-simple-teaser-block .alignleft{
	margin-right: 0;
}
.post_tags{
text-align: left;
}

.post_tags a{
background: none;
padding: 4px 5px;
color: #000;
}
.post-navigation{
	display: none;
}
article.category-autoren h2{
	color: #acbb0a;
}
article.category-verbaende h2{
	color: #fcc521;
}
article.category-firmen h2{
	color: #85d0f0;
}
span#vb{
	color: #fcc521;
} 
span#au{
	color: #acbb0a;
}
span#fi{
	color: #85d0f0;
}
.rltdpstsplgn-popular-posts header{
	margin-bottom: 10px;
}
.rltdpstsplgn-popular-posts header h3{
	font-size: 14px;
	margin-bottom: 0;
}
.rltdpstsplgn-popular-posts article{
	padding: 0 30px;
}
.sidebar-widget-area .widget{
  padding: 0;
	margin-bottom: 30px;
}
.sidebar-widget-area .widget .widget-title{
	background: #dae900;
}
.sidebar-widget-area .widget .widget-title h2{
	padding-left: 10px;
	vertical-align: middle;
	color: #697206;
	line-height: 2;
	text-align: left
}
.blocks-gallery-item a{
	color: #fff;
}
#post-382 div.gosign-simple-teaser-block{

	width:335px;
	margin-right:10px;
}
#post-382 div.gosign-simple-teaser-block img{
	padding:15px 15px 15px 0;
}
#post-1924 .the_content ul{
	padding: 0;
}
.pt-cv-wrapper .btn-success{
	color:#000;
	background-color: #fff;
	border-color: #fff;
}
.page-id-384 img.pt-cv-thumbnail{
 height: 150px ! important;
 width: 230px ! important;	
} 
img.pt-cv-thumbnail{
	height: 200px ! important;
 width: 360px ! important;	
}
.the_content blockquote{
  background-image: url(/wp-content/uploads/2020/03/anfuehrungszeichen.png);
  background-repeat: no-repeat;
	border: none;
} 
.the_content blockquote p{
	padding-left: 20px;
	font-size: 14px;
}
.quot {
	display:block; 
	margin:0 0 10px 0;
	
}
.quot img{
	float: left;
	margin-right:15px;
	width: 44px;
	height: 44px;
}
.quot p{
	font-style:italic;
	font-size: 15px;
	margin-left: 60px;
}
.card img{
	height: 210px;
}
.section-title h1::after{
	background-color: #697206;
}
#post-2389 .blocks-gallery-item figcaption a{
	color: transparent;
} 
#post-2389 .blocks-gallery-item figcaption a:hover{
	background-color: transparent;
}
#post-2389 .blocks-gallery-item figcaption{
	background: none;
	max-height: none;
}
.page-id-2448 img.pt-cv-thumbnail{
 height: 110px ;
 width: 360px ! important;	
} 
.page-id-2448 .pt-cv-ifield a:hover{
	background-color: transparent;
}
#media_image-11{
	padding: 0;
}
#media_image-11 .widget-title{
	margin-bottom: 0;
}
#text-13,#text-14,#text-15{
	margin-bottom: 10px;
}
#tribe-events-pg-template.tribe-events-pg-template{
	max-width: 1170px;
    position: relative;
    width: 100%;
    padding-left: 20px;
    padding-right: 15px;
	font-size: 16px;
}
h4.tribe-event-title{
	font-size: 16px;
	color: #697206;
}
h4.tribe-event-title a{
	color: #697206;
}
h4.tribe-event-title a:hover{
	color: #dae900;
}
#tribe-events-content a{
	color: #697206;
}
.tribe-block__venue .tribe-block__venue__meta .tribe-block__venue__name h3{
	font-size: 2rem;
}
.tribe-block__venue .tribe-block__venue__meta .tribe-block__venue__address{
	font-size: 1.75rem;
}
span.tribe-block__venue__website a{
	font-size: 1.75rem;
}

.tribe-block__venue__meta{
  width: 49%;
  flex-basis: 49%;
}
.tribe-block__venue__map{
  width: 49%;
  flex-basis: 49%;
}
#post-1553 p {
 	margin: 20px 0;
}
.tribe-events-schedule__time--start {
  display: none;
}
.tribe-events-schedule__time--end {
  display: none;
}
.tribe-events-schedule__separator--date{
  display: none;
}
.tribe-block__venue .tribe-block__venue__meta .tribe-block__venue__phone{
	font-size: 1.75rem;
}
#tribe-events-footer{
	display: none;
}
p.tribe-events-widget-link a{
  padding: 0 30px;
}
#html5_cumulus-2.widget.html5_cumulus canvas{
	padding: 0 20px 20px 20px;
}
#custom_html-11{
  padding: 0 30px;
}

.wp-block-audio audio{
	max-width: 450px;
}

.page-id-4523 #media_image-12{
	display: inline;
}
.gsc-input-box table{
	margin-bottom: 0;
}
form table.gsc-search-box{
	margin-bottom: 20px;
}
input#gsc-i-id1.gsc-input {
	background:url()!important ;
}
figure.imghover.image-holder{
	padding-bottom: 56.25% !important
}
.wp-block-image figcaption{
	text-align: left;
}
.metaslider.caption{
	font-size: 14px;
}

._3d-flip-book .book-thumbnail img{
	width: 200px;
}
.fb3d-h-180 {
    
    float: left;
    margin-right: 15px;
} 
.wp-block-audio audio{
	max-width: 100%;
}
.wp-block-audio figcaption{
	text-align: left;
}
.wp-block-embed figcaption{
	text-align: left;
}
.page-id-650 aside#secondary.sidebar-widget-area {
	display:none;
}
.page-id-16303 aside#secondary.sidebar-widget-area {
	display:none;
}
article#post-16303{
	background-color: #dedede;
}
.page-id-16303 .page-container .cm-col-lg-8 {
	flex: 0 0 99.666667%;
    max-width: 99.666667%;
	background-color: #dedede;
    box-shadow: 0 0 15px;
	padding: 10px 20px;
}
.page-id-650 .page-container .cm-col-lg-8 {
	flex: 0 0 100%;
	max-width: 100%;
}
.postid-14877 aside#secondary.sidebar-widget-area{
	display:none;
}
.postid-14877 .single-container .cm-col-lg-8{
	flex: 0 0 100%;
	max-width: 100%;
}
.postid-14877 .wp-block-video{
	margin-bottom: 30px;
}
#origincode_videogallery_container_moving_3{
		background-color: #333333;
    box-shadow: 0 0 15px;
}	
.video-element_3 .image-block_3 {
  margin: 10px 0 0 12px;
}
.play-icon.youtube-icon{
	display:	none;
}
.wp-block-embed-globalmagazin{
	margin-left: 8%;
}

.postid-18917 .wp-block-columns figure.wp-block-embed-globalmagazin{
	margin-left: 0;
}
.postid-19036 .wp-block-columns figure.wp-block-embed-globalmagazin{
	margin-left: 0;
	
}


.twitter-tweet{
	margin-left:11%;
}
.widget.aiovg-widget-videos{
	padding: 0 10px;
}
.widget.aiovg-widget-search{
	padding: 0 10px;
}
.widget.widget_metaslider_widget{
	padding: 0 10px;
}
.widget.widget_categories{
	padding: 0 10px;
}
#custom_html-11{
	padding: 0;
}
#custom_html-11 .textwidget {
	padding: 0 10px;
}
.postid-18139 .pgcsimplygalleryblock-slider-item .pgcsimplygalleryblock-slider-item-inner .pgcsimplygalleryblock-slider-title-wrap{
	top: 21.5em !important;
}
.postid-11023 ._3d-flip-book .book-thumbnail img {
    width: 100%;
}
.aiovg-views.aiovg-text-muted{
	display: none;
}
.ccfic-text a{
	color: #FBC729;
}
.ms-edit-frontend{
	display: none;
}


/*pdf-ripa*/
.postid-17622 .general-header{
	display: none;
}
.postid-17622 .footer{
	display: none;
}
.postid-20170 .general-header{
	display: none;
}
.postid-20170 .footer{
	display: none;
}
.postid-22608 .general-header{
	display: none;
}
.postid-22608 .footer{
	display: none;
}
.postid-26025 .general-header{
	display: none;
}
.postid-26025 .footer{
	display: none;
}
.postid-28598 .general-header{
	display: none;
}
.postid-28598 .footer{
	display: none;
}
.postid-29331 .general-header{
	display: none;
}
.postid-29331 .footer{
	display: none;
}
/*ende*/